Set a Record but Missed the Century
During this innings, Vaibhav set a major record. He completed his half-century in just 42 balls, becoming the youngest cricketer to score a fifty in the history of the Duleep Trophy.
Despite this, at a score of 92, he attempted to complete his century with a six and was caught on the boundary line.
Repeated the Mistake for the 7th Time This Year
This is the seventh time this year that Vaibhav Suryavanshi has been dismissed after getting close to a century. This weakness of his is consistently emerging, for which he has received advice multiple times.
Even in a tournament like the Duleep Trophy with no over limits, he did not show patience and threw his wicket away after facing 81 balls.
When Did Vaibhav Miss His Centuries?
Vaibhav's nervous 90s problem has been evident on several important occasions this year.
- Under-19 World Cup: Got out for 96 runs off 50 balls in a warm-up match against Scotland.
- IPL 2026: Scored 93 runs off 38 balls against Lucknow Supergiants.
- IPL 2026: Was dismissed for 97 runs off 29 balls against Sunrisers Hyderabad in the Eliminator.
- IPL 2026: Returned to the pavilion after scoring 96 runs off 47 balls against Gujarat Titans in Qualifier 2.
Same Story at the International Level
After the IPL, many veterans advised him to be patient. He was then given a chance in the India A team, where he scored the fastest half-century in List A history (in 11 balls) against Sri Lanka A, but in that match too, he was out for 94 runs on the 29th ball.
Following that, during his international debut against Zimbabwe, he also missed a century and was dismissed for 81 runs.
